Transaction 8456a123824592659c0577d23af10057d63595e48615dfb59202690bcd82029c

1 Input
2 Outputs
  • 8456a123824592659c0577d23af10057d63595e48615dfb59202690bcd82029c:0
  • value  11479835
    address  1AtvdtbxHBNcSmMHuqEXE8pnefoksGgNkS
  • 8456a123824592659c0577d23af10057d63595e48615dfb59202690bcd82029c:1
  • value  73292465
    address  1EKsNX2Xjdt8goXh1iJ7TstS6jTjJmf4zq